Technical Project Engineer, Laboratory Systems & Interfaces

Clinisys

Reference: 1670909420

Building an AI-first organisation is central to Clinisys' purpose and the impact we deliver. As a global provider of intelligent diagnostic informatics solutions, we build AI-enabled, cloud-based platforms to enhance diagnostic workflows across healthcare, life sciences, and public health. By applying intelligent technology thoughtfully and responsibly, we help laboratories and testing environments operate more effectively, generate meaningful insights at scale, and ultimately support healthier and safer communities. Operating across more than 30 countries, Clinisys expects all colleagues-regardless of role or function - to work confidently with AI-enabled tools, apply digital and analytical thinking, and continuously adapt as technologies evolve, must drive an AI first sense of purpose and urgency.

Clinisys has built an unrivalled reputation for deploying complex diagnostic networks and academic centres - and is the only provider to repetitively deliver to all disciplines end-to-end - at scale. Fostering healthier communities.

Clinisys laboratory information systems are used in a wide range of laboratory areas: haematology, bacteriology, clinical chemistry, serology, immunology, toxicology, microbiology, epidemiology, virology, pathology, genetics, blood transfusion, clinical trials, veterinary medicine, human genetics. With the products GLIMS, Genetic module, DaVinci and CyberLab, Clinisys has leading solutions for its customers in Europe.

The role

As a Technical Project Engineer, you will be responsible for the technical implementation and integration of Clinisys laboratory solutions. Your focus will include programming interfaces, connecting laboratory instruments and devices, and integrating systems within customer IT environments. Previous laboratory knowledge is beneficial but not essential.

Key responsibilities

  • Design, configure, program and test interfaces between laboratory systems, analysers, instruments, devices and external applications.
  • Deliver technical implementation activities including systems analysis, data architecture, integration workshops and validation support.
  • Investigate connectivity and data-flow issues, identify technical risks and coordinate solutions with customers and Development.
  • Manage assigned technical workstreams or small integration projects in line with agreed project plans and budgets.
  • Produce technical documentation and deliver customer handovers, training, system updates and upgrades.
  • Support Project Management, Customer Services, Support and Sales with technical analysis and implementation planning.

Experience and qualifications

  • Degree, vocational qualification or equivalent professional experience in IT, software engineering, computer science or a related technical discipline.
  • Programming or scripting experience, particularly involving system interfaces, data exchange or application integration.
  • Experience connecting software platforms, laboratory instruments, analysers or other technical devices.
  • Knowledge of healthcare interoperability standards such as HL7, ASTM or IHE.
  • Understanding of operating systems, networking and virtualised environments; LIS, LIMS or laboratory knowledge is beneficial.
  • Fluent German and professional proficiency in English.

Location

Germany; Salary: €69,305 - €86,632 - €103,958 (per annum, depending on experience, skills, and qualifications)
